Emotional Peak – Muthu (1995, Tamil)
Alongside Rajinikanth, Kushboo played Ranganayaki. The scene where she realizes the servant (Rajini) is actually the landlord’s son and her lover is pure cinematic emotion. From 1989 to 1999, Kushboo juggled multiple languages (Tamil, Telugu, Malayalam, and Kannada) with ease, starring in over 80 films. She became the highest-paid actress of her time, often receiving top billing alongside male superstars like Rajinikanth, Kamal Haasan, Chiranjeevi, and Venkatesh.
